Touch Piano
- Maps seven touch inputs to notes and colours
- Provides sound, light, and on-screen feedback
- Tests response and playability
Plant Care Assistant
- Measures temperature, humidity, and soil moisture
- Calibrates thresholds for plant conditions
- Controls watering with safe local rules
Air Detective Station
- Reads particulate and environmental data
- Validates and classifies air conditions
- Presents results through OLED pages and alerts
